ebony

eb·on·y

ebony

 
pronunciation:
e b ni
parts of speech:
noun, adjective
features:
Word Combinations (noun), Word Explorer
part of speech: noun
inflections: ebonies
definition 1: a hard heavy wood, often black, from various tropical Asian trees.
definition 2: a tree that produces this wood.
definition 3: a deep shiny black color.
similar words:
jet
Word CombinationsSubscriber feature About this feature
 
part of speech: adjective
definition 1: made of or resembling ebony.
definition 2: of a shiny black color.
similar words:
jet
